The average salary in San Antonio is $1,271 per week, compared to $980 in Tacoma.

Salary Comparison

CityWeekly Salary
San Antonio$1,271
Tacoma$980

Cost of Living Comparison

CityCost IndexRent Index
San Antonio8680
Tacoma6862

Which city is cheaper and better?

Is San Antonio cheaper than Tacoma? Based on the data above, Tacoma generally has lower living costs, especially in rent and daily expenses.

However, San Antonio offers higher average salaries, which may offset the higher cost of living.

San Antonio vs Tacoma: Final Verdict

If you are looking for affordability, Tacoma is generally the better option. If you prioritise higher income and job opportunities, San Antonio may be more attractive.
